Transaction 58404e7895ee3874e9e5596ac394037ffcf6299d1003460ad09258996df8c367
1 Input
2 Outputs
- 58404e7895ee3874e9e5596ac394037ffcf6299d1003460ad09258996df8c367:0
- 58404e7895ee3874e9e5596ac394037ffcf6299d1003460ad09258996df8c367:1
value 28170828
address 161AiyQ9eggkps1YAfmYwR1FwjLJJMyN2W
value 27269232
address 3KaLNhD4YkNJz6Xd39p8P1vkSs4Cc1WhPM